Despite heavy rain, over 100 people gathered to demand an end to the U.S. wars on Afghanistan and Iraq.
Along with hundreds of supporters, veterans of Iraq, Afghanistan, Vietnam, Korea, WWII and more marched solemnly from a rally in Lafayette Park to the fence immediately in front of the White House, refusing to leave.
